Eyes on Brickell: Reasons Contact Lenses Are Popular

Seven Reasons Why Contact Lenses Are Such A Popular Vision Solution

Clearer vision – Contact lenses sit right against the surface of your eye, hugging the natural curvature. Due to this, they give you a wider field of view (better peripheral vision) and less of the visual distortion which is common when wearing eyeglasses.
